Description
La Feliciana Peach is a vigorous, Southern-bred peach tree that delivers large, flavorful harvests even in hot and humid climates. Developed in Louisiana, this variety is prized for its adaptability to southern gardens and its ability to produce firm, sweet peaches with minimal chill hour requirements. Whether you enjoy fresh peaches off the tree, bake them into cobblers, or preserve them as jam, La Feliciana delivers season after season.
- Large, yellow-skinned peaches blushed with deep red at harvest
- Firm, sweet flesh perfect for fresh eating, baking, and preserving
- Low chill hour requirement, ideal for warm, humid southern climates
- Fast-growing tree that may produce fruit in its first year
- Self-fruitful, but yields increase with a companion peach nearby
- Grows 15–25 ft. tall in full sun locations
- Hardy in Zones 5–9
Plant La Feliciana Peach in full sun and well-drained soil for best results. This tree performs exceptionally well in the South and Gulf Coast states, thriving where other peach varieties struggle with heat and humidity. Water regularly during establishment and fertilize in early spring to encourage vigorous growth and maximum fruit production. Thin fruit clusters early in the season to promote larger, better-quality peaches. Harvest typically occurs in midsummer for a juicy, rewarding crop.
